I hope your laptop is fixed soon.Stray Stitches (Linda G)https://www.blogger.com/profile/13745220686468103536no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-526411601177285975.post-59916671186734375432011-04-18T03:01:34.507-04:002011-04-18T03:01:34.507-04:00I'm guessing that the window that popped up sa...I'm guessing that the window that popped up saying the laptop had 19 viruses was actually the culprit. Unless you were actually running a scan with your antivirus program, I don't think they just come up that way.<br />Should that happen again, be suspicious! Do NOT click on ANY pop-up windows. Better to restart the computer, then run your antivirus program & let it do its job.<br />I've been surfing online for a loooong time, and have been very fortunate. Possibly because I've always had a fear of downloading! lol I never click on links in emails, even from friends. I would rather copy & paste, or retype the link. I always hover over a link too, & check where it's really going by looking down at the bar at the bottom of the browser.<br />Good luck!quiltzyxh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/08847188443140845514no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-526411601177285975.post-83425823066913784142011-04-17T21:25:24.230-04:002011-04-17T21:25:24.230-04:00Not much worse than not being able to play on the ...Not much worse than not being able to play on the Internet. It sounds like you went to a site that tries to trick you into believing you have a virus and as soon as you click that you want to repair the virus it downloads programs into your computer. The easy way out is to shut the page down and click cancel when they ask you to run virus protection. Those viruses always mimic Windows security alerts but they arent genuine.<br /><br />I've fixed this before by just doing a system restore. Easy. We got nasty malaware on our computer a couple of months ago that hijacked the programs and wouldnt let me access our computer . Since I knew what the virus was I started the computer in safe mode (Just continually press F8 while your computer is booting up) and googled for a solution. The hard and fast rule is that anti virus protection while good will never keep everything off your computer since new viruses are being developed and sent out to the internet every day ..<br /><br />Hope they can get it fixed for you.Shayh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/11032969125788408807noreply@blogger.com
